Overview

Becoming a welder in Brigham City, ID, typically begins with technical training, which can range from 6 months to 2 years, providing both theoretical knowledge and practical skills. According to the American Welding Society, there are approximately 771,000 welding professionals in the U.S., with a median annual salary of $45,190. In Brigham City, welders can expect to earn an average of $1,880 per week, with experienced professionals earning even more. With the industry experiencing a 2-3% growth rate and a significant demand for new welders due to an aging workforce, aspiring welders in Brigham City have promising career prospects and the potential to earn a competitive wage.
